The Huawei nova 5T is a little bit better than HTC U Play, having an 80.8 score against 73.5. The Huawei nova 5T design has the same thickness than the HTC U Play, but it's somewhat heavier. Huawei nova 5T has a bit sharper screen than HTC U Play, because although it has a bit less pixels per inch of screen, it also counts with a larger display and a slightly higher 1080 x 2340 resolution.
HTC U Play has a way bigger storage to install applications and games or saving photos and videos than Huawei nova 5T, because although it has 0 less internal storage, it also counts with a SD extension slot that holds up to 1,95 TB. Huawei nova 5T counts with just a little better hardware performance than HTC U Play, and although they both have 8 CPU cores, the Huawei nova 5T also has more RAM.
Huawei nova 5T counts with a much longer battery lifetime than HTC U Play, because it has a 3750mAh battery size instead of 2500mAh. Huawei nova 5T captures much better videos and photos than HTC U Play, because it has a lot higher resolution back facing camera, a way better 3840x2160 (4K) video resolution and a bigger camera aperture to capture better captures and video in low light situations.
Even being the best phone in this comparison, Huawei nova 5T is also cheaper than the HTC U Play, making it an easy decision.
